Revenue Stability and Adjusted Strategy:
- reported total revenues of $444.8 million for Q2 2025, up 2% year-over-year.
- This growth was attributed to strategic shifts in ad product and sales strategy, focusing on expanding and solidifying customers' mindset of choosing Weibo as a go-to platform for content marketing.

User Growth and Engagement:
- Weibo's MAUs and average DAUs reached 588 million and 261 million respectively in June 2025, representing a net addition of 5 million users each on a year-over-year basis.
- The increase was driven by enhancements in recommendation and search functions through AI integrations, enhancing user engagement and scale.

Advertising Revenue and Industry Performance:
- Weibo's total ad revenues reached $383.4 million, up 2% year-over-year.
- Growth was fueled by increased ad spend from e-commerce platforms during the June shopping festival and the key role Weibo plays in the automobile sector, particularly in new energy vehicle launches.

AI Integration and Product Innovation:
- Weibo's intelligent search saw robust growth, with MAUs surpassing 50 million in June, and daily active users increasing notably.
- The integration of AI-powered search optimized model strategies and enriched databases, leading to improved user experience and increased query frequency.
